Jean d´Assonville appointed a director of The Airplane Factory -131
Sat, 20 Mar 2010
by Airplane Factory
Jean d’Assonville, previously the quality controller and test pilot for Shadowlite, (manufacturer of Jabiru aircraft in South Africa), acquired a minority shareholding in and was appointed a director of The Airplane Factory. Jean is working on the establishment of efficient, consistent and safe production procedures for Airplane Factory Aircraft.

Awards Evening -122
Mon, 07 Sep 2009
by Airplane Factory
Mike Blyth and James Pitman won the the James Gilliland Trophee at the annual Aeroclub of South Africa Awards evening. Congratulations to both of you for a well deserved award!
